WebThe ammonium ion is the conjugate acid of the base ammonia, NH 3; its acid ionization (or acid hydrolysis) reaction is represented by. NH 4 + ( a q) + H 2 O ( l) ⇌ H 3 O + ( a q) + NH 3 ( a q) K a = K w / K b. Since ammonia is a weak base, Kb is measurable and Ka > 0 (ammonium ion is a weak acid). WebMar 21, 2024 · Write the chemical formula for an ionic compound composed of each pair of ions. the calcium ion and the oxygen ion the 2+ copper ion and the sulfur ion the 1+ copper ion and the sulfur ion … WebApr 7, 2024 · Those ions which are formed from single atoms are called simple ions. They are also called as monoatomic ions. For Example: Sodium ion, chloride ion, magnesium ion, aluminum ion, oxide ion etc. Polyatomic Ions Those ions which are formed from groups of joined atoms are called as polyatomic ions. WebSimple Ions. The positive ion is place first in the formula, the negative ion is second. For example, Kf, CuO; Positive and negative ions are combined so that the total number of positive charges is balanced by the total number of negative charges. An ion is defined as an atom or molecule that has gained or lost one or more of its valence electrons, giving it a net positive or negative electrical charge. In other words, there is an imbalance in the number of protons (positively charged particles) and electrons (negatively charged particles) in a chemical species.

WebSimple ions from non-metals have their endings changed to " ide ". So the ions are called nitride, oxide, sulfide, fluoride, chloride, bromide, and iodide. Not all of the non-metals form simple ions.
